    What module is Neverwinter running off of?
    I'm not sure what you mean? Neverwinter is the game itself, we will be making "modules" called User Generated Content, (A.K.A. "UGC" or "Foundry Missions") that are accessed through the game world itself. It is not going to allow player-ran servers, for this is not Neverwinter Nights 3. It is not a continuation of that series but instead it's own, based off of not the prior games but off of the literary works by R.A. Salvatore's "Neverwinter Saga" novels and WotC's 4th Edition "Forgotten Realms Neverwinter Campaign Setting" source material.

    If you mean game engine: Neverwinter is running off of a modified and updated version of their Cryptic Engine. Earlier versions of this Engine are used in STO and CO. Neverwinter's version also has incorporated new technologies that sets it apart from the earlier versions of the Engine.

    viaxus wrote: »
    Sorry if this has been asked many many times already, but I have been unable to find an exact answer to my question.

    Lets say someone tries to create Menzoberranzan as an area. Is there a population cap on that UGC? As in, how many players will be able to access that area at any one time? I believe the cap in NWN 2 was around 60-ish players per persistant world. Any word on the numbers here? Thanks in advance!
    For custom maps:-
    1 party per instance and as many instances as you want. 1 party is 5 people. All the people on server may be playing same quest in their own instances.

    For public maps:-
    No limit.

    ~~~~
    The cap is in number of objects, number of map and number of encounters per quest. The limits for NW foundry have not been revealed, but STO foundry's limits are out there somewhere(if you search around for them).

    i.e. When you create your own map, if the number of objects (say/assume/hypothetical) exceeds 15,000 - you will need to break your map into two.

    If your quest has more than (say/assume/hypothetical) 7 maps, and you need 10, you will need to break them up to two quests. etc.
